[QUOTE="food4thought, post: 71642368, member: 3467"] It sounds to me as though you already know it is an evil spirit, since "it is capable of hurting physically". I wonder what you mean by that, by the way. It is good that you are praying, but in your situation, where your faith is weak, it is necessary for you to go to a church that actually believes the Bible (not all churches do) and get some mature Christians to pray over you and with you for deliverance. You also need to follow Lily's advice and make a full commitment to follow Christ. If you are not born again, with the Holy Spirit living inside you, you will always struggle with these evil spirits because you will not have the authority to command them to leave you alone. Jesus claimed to be more than a good man, He claimed to be equal to the Father. Jesus cannot be just a good man, because good men do not make false or delusional claims. If He was not equal to the Father, then He was delusional or a downright liar. Either He was God in human form, or He was crazy, or He was a liar... but He did not leave us the option of simply calling Him a good man. [/QUOTE]
